SubjectRe: [PATCH] software node: recursively unregister child swnodes
On Thu, Jun 04, 2020 at 12:36:23PM -0700, jorhand@linux.microsoft.com wrote:
> From: Jordan Hand <jorhand@linux.microsoft.com>
>
> If a child swnode is unregistered after it's parent, it can lead to
> undefined behavior.

Crashing the system is not really "undefined" :)

> When a swnode is unregistered, recursively free it's children to avoid
> this condition.

Are you sure? Why would you be unregistering a child after it's parent?
Why not just do not do that?

You should document that you just changed the behaivor here, as you are
now really doing fwnode_remove_software_node_and_all_children().

but again, why? Who wants to unregister a child before a parent?
